About The Artwork

Faster than Apple: this I-Phone 7s (seven deadly sins) offers seven latin titled applications (Avaritia; Luxuria; Superbia; Acedia; Ira; Gula and Invidia)! The fresco-painting is framed with a stainless steelframe and covered with glass, according to the real I-Phone. There are no electrical devices used.

Professional Painter since 1985. My "unique selling point" is the mixed media-technique fresco combined with real rust. All paintings are covered with two layers of resin!! My artistic topics are almost unlimited. Since 2014 I‘m busy again in watercolors. This very difficult technique allows me to work in an well orderly former baroque teahouse, which is open to all public during my times of presence. It is located in a beautiful park used by many tourists. Further information see on my website: www.benno-noll.de
